IR Film Review: 28 YEARS LATER [Sony]

The conceit of "28 Years Later" is a concept of how life has changed against the backdrop of the rage and the ideas at play. It is split into two parts. The crux of the film is Spike who is the eyes through which the new generation will see this quarantined world.

IR Film Review: CIVIL WAR [A24]

The contradiction of perspective sometimes offers a different perception in certain ways. With the film "Civil War", writer/director Alex Garland again seeks to stir the pot philosphically while using real world perspectives to engage ideas of conpiracy, hurt and misdirection.
